A class has 175 students. The following table shows the number of students studying one or more of the following subjects in this class :
SubjectNumber of students
Mathematics100
Physics70
Chemistry46
Mathematics and Physics30
Mathematics and Chemistry28
Physics and Chemistry23
Mathematics, Physics and Chemistry18
How many students are enrolled in Mathematics alone, Physics alone and Chemistry alone ? Are there students who have not offered any of these three subjects ?
